We see discrepancies in the hindu tradition when it comes to women. Over centuries, women have faced restrictions in religious practices and are constantly relegated to the background. However, do these long practiced customs have any basis in the scriptures? Do they have the scriptural sanction? This important talk by Swaminiji not only examines what the primary texts say about women but goes a step further to reiterate why a women is primed and geared for mokṣa.
